It ain’t Allentown, but Hamburg, Pennsylvania will have to do as this week features a look at WWF All Star Wrestling from May 17, 1980! - Bob Backlund vs El Olympico in a bizarre “exhibition of wrestling holds” as VINCE MCMAHON delights in scientific wrestling - The future problem Larry Z would have coming out of the Bruno feud - Ken Patera as a God among men in 1980 even beyond the WWF - Hulk Hogan being better in ’80 than remembered even as the promotion would prefer people forget his main feud that year - Lots of Bruno Sammartino commentary: on Mexican wrestling, arrogant heels, fat people, Larry Z and more! - Tor Kamata and his comical real name - Steve King and the same name game - 1980 Wrestler kneepad watch Plus: - One wiseacre in Hamburg has some advice for Backlund and Olympico - Autograph seekers at the TV tapings and their fascination with job guys - Sitcoms that did exactly 117 episodes - Hulk Hogan: golfer? - Sports moments of 2017: A first in Major League Baseball, 10 home runs in one game, and an obsession with the final play of regulation from Super Bowl 51 Email: [email protected] Twitter: @GFAllentownPod Facebook.com/GreetingsFromAllentown Prowestlingonly.com
